Hello, I gave my NEET this year, and you know how the paper went. My parents don't want me to take a drop, because they don't know how hard the paper will be. Just like this year. I'm 17. I got my BOARD marks, and they also aren't good. My parents are getting a chance to send me to Georgia to continue my MBBS, but my mom is against it. She's making me do BSc where I don't want to. I've always wanted to become a doctor, She feels that since I couldn't crack NEET UG, how will I ever crack PG? She thinks I can't focus. And I don't blame her. I feel like I have ADHD, but I just can't tell my parents. How can I convince my parents to please let me do MBBS in Georgia?

Ans: Hello Neeyam.
Please talk with your any family member to which you are comfortable and your parents too. The problem can be solved with mutual discussion only. There are many pros and cons of persuing MBBS at abroad. First know them very well and then decide about study at abroad. Or simply talk with your parents very closely and ask them to give you one more chance to appear for NEET and board exam (improvement) to prove yourself. Nothing is impossible in the life. Many students have cracked NEET while repeating. You can also be one of them. If possible, ask your parents to talk with me also via follow-up section. Best of luck to your upcoming future.
